
Write the chemical formula of calcium carbonate.

Hint:To find out the chemical formula of calcium carbonate we first need to find out from which cation and anion the molecule is made of. So, the molecule is formed by the calcium cation $C{a^{ + 2}}$ and the carbonate anion $C{O_3}^{ - 2}$.
Complete answer:
Calcium carbonate is a chemical compound largely used as additive in agriculture and it is also sold as a calcium supplement. Calcium carbonate is frequently found in nature as a component of rocks, corals, pearls, marine organism shells, eggshell and snail shell. It is also found in geological formations in the mineral calcite, dolomite, variety and aragonite or lime. It is also found dissolved in hard water. The calcium carbonate chemical formula is $CaC{O_3}$ and its molar mass is 100.0869 g mol-1. The molecule is formed by the calcium cation $C{a^{ + 2}}$ and the carbonate anion $C{O_3}^{ - 2}$. The structure of the calcium carbonate lattice depends on the mineral from which it is extracted: the calcite contains a hexagonal calcium carbonate structure while the aragonite contains orthorhombic lattice. Its chemical structure can be written as below, in the common representations used for organic molecules.
Thus, the chemical formula of the calcium carbonate is $CaC{O_3}$.
Note:
Calcium carbonate has many applications in industry and directly as a drug. Similar to other calcium compounds and carbonates of group two metals, it is mainly used to obtain building materials as stucco and cement. Calcium carbonate is also used in the production of sugar from beet and in the chalk used in blackboard. It is also an additive in diapers, coats and paints.
